use std::io::{self, Cursor, Write};
use azalea_buf::{AzBuf, AzaleaRead, AzaleaReadVar, AzaleaWrite, AzaleaWriteVar, BufReadError};
use azalea_chat::{
FormattedText,
translatable_component::{StringOrComponent, TranslatableComponent},
};
use azalea_core::bitset::BitSet;
use azalea_crypto::MessageSignature;
use azalea_protocol_macros::ClientboundGamePacket;
use azalea_registry::Holder;
use simdnbt::owned::NbtCompound;
use uuid::Uuid;
#[derive(Clone, Debug, AzBuf, ClientboundGamePacket, PartialEq)]
pub struct ClientboundPlayerChat {
#[var]
pub global_index: u32,
pub sender: Uuid,
#[var]
pub index: u32,
pub signature: Option<MessageSignature>,
pub body: PackedSignedMessageBody,
pub unsigned_content: Option<FormattedText>,
pub filter_mask: FilterMask,
pub chat_type: ChatTypeBound,
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ub struct PackedSignedMessageBody {
// the error is here, for some reason it skipped a byte earlier and here
// it's reading `0` when it should be `11`
pub content: String,
pub timestamp: u64,
pub salt: u64,
pub last_seen: PackedLastSeenMessages,
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ub struct PackedLastSeenMessages {
pub entries: Vec<PackedMessageSignature>,
}
/// Messages can be deleted by either their signature or message id.
#[derive(Clone, Debug, PartialEq)]
pub enum PackedMessageSignature {
Signature(Box<MessageSignature>),
Id(u32),
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ub enum FilterMask {
PassThrough,
FullyFiltered,
PartiallyFiltered(BitSet),
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ub struct ChatTypeBound {
pub chat_type: Holder<azalea_registry::ChatType, DirectChatType>,
pub name: FormattedText,
pub target_name: Option<FormattedText>,
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ub struct DirectChatType {
pub chat: ChatTypeDecoration,
pub narration: ChatTypeDecoration,
}
#[derive(Clone, Debug, PartialEq, AzBuf)]
pub struct ChatTypeDecoration {
pub translation_key: String,
pub parameters: Vec<ChatTypeDecorationParameter>,
pub style: NbtCompound,
}
#[derive(Clone, Copy, Debug, PartialEq, AzBuf)]
pub enum ChatTypeDecorationParameter {
Sender = 0,
Target = 1,
Content = 2,
}
// must be in Client
#[derive(Clone, Debug, PartialEq)]
pub struct MessageSignatureCache {
pub entries: Vec<Option<MessageSignature>>,
}
impl ClientboundPlayerChat {
/// Returns the content of the message. If you want to get the FormattedText
/// for the whole message including the sender part, use
/// [`ClientboundPlayerChat::message`].
#[must_use]
pub fn content(&self) -> FormattedText {
self.unsigned_content
.clone()
.unwrap_or_else(|| FormattedText::from(self.body.content.clone()))
}
/// Get the full message, including the sender part.
#[must_use]
pub fn message(&self) -> FormattedText {
let sender = self.chat_type.name.clone();
let content = self.content();
let target = self.chat_type.target_name.clone();
let mut args = vec![
StringOrComponent::FormattedText(sender),
StringOrComponent::FormattedText(content),
];
if let Some(target) = target {
args.push(StringOrComponent::FormattedText(target));
}
let translation_key = self.chat_type.translation_key();
let component = TranslatableComponent::new(translation_key.to_string(), args);
FormattedText::Translatable(component)
}
}
impl ChatTypeBound {
pub fn translation_key(&self) -> &str {
match &self.chat_type {
Holder::Reference(r) => r.chat_translation_key(),
Holder::Direct(d) => d.chat.translation_key.as_str(),
}
}
}
impl AzaleaRead for PackedMessageSignature {
fn azalea_read(buf: &mut Cursor<&[u8]>) -> Result<Self, BufReadError> {
let id = u32::azalea_read_var(buf)?;
if id == 0 {
let full_signature = MessageSignature::azalea_read(buf)?;
Ok(PackedMessageSignature::Signature(Box::new(full_signature)))
} else {
Ok(PackedMessageSignature::Id(id - 1))
}
}
}
impl AzaleaWrite for PackedMessageSignature {
fn azalea_write(&self, buf: &mut impl Write) -> io::Result<()> {
match self {
PackedMessageSignature::Signature(full_signature) => {
0u32.azalea_write_var(buf)?;
full_signature.azalea_write(buf)?;
}
PackedMessageSignature::Id(id) => {
(id + 1).azalea_write_var(buf)?;
}
}
Ok(())
}
}
